Syracuse was able to      convert on one of three power-play opportunities. The penalty      kill unit shut down three of five Utica man      advantages.    <\/p>\n<p>      The victory moves the Crunch to      29-30-4-7 on the season and 2-1-1-0 in the season series with      the Comets. Despite tonight's win, the Comets have taken the      Galaxy Cup.    <\/p>\n<p>      The Crunch led the Comets, 2-1, after      the first period. Philippe Paradis put the Crunch on the      board with a breakaway goal 7:16 into the period. Vladislav      Namestnikov passed ahead to Paradis, who faked right and beat      Eriksson on the glove side. Joey Mormina was credited with      the secondary assist. The Comets evened the score five      minutes later. Cal O'Reilly found the back of the net with a      power-play goal at the 12:26 mark. O'Reilly put the puck top      shelf with a slap shot from the left circle off an assist      from Alex Biega. Syracuse went up 2-1 with a power-play goal      by Yanni Gourde. With 3:16 remaining, Gourde netted a slap      shot from the right point. Dmitry Korobov and Jon DiSalvatore      each earned a point on the go-ahead goal.    <\/p>\n<p>      The Comets took a 3-2 lead in the      middle frame with two goals from Alex Friesen. Friesen netted      a shot at the 11:39 mark with an assist from Kellan Lain to      tie the Crunch at two. Utica took the lead with 1:33 left in      the period. Biega fired from the left circle, but was stopped      by Gudlevskis. Friesen picked up the rebound and scored the      power-play goal. Jeremy Welsh picked up his first point of      the game for the assist.    <\/p>\n<p>      The Comets built up a three-goal lead      with the first two goals of the third period. O'Reilly passed      across the crease to Patrick Kennedy, who one-timed it for a      4-2 lead 9:44 into the period. Welsh extended the lead a      minute later when he picked up the rebound of Friesen's shot      from the left circle. Yann Sauve earned a point with the      secondary assist.    <\/p>\n<p>      The Crunch scored three times in 46      seconds at the end of the third to force an extra frame.      Paradis passed across the slot to Namestnikov, who began the      Crunch's late rally with 1:39 left in regulation. Cedric      Paquette was credited with the secondary assist. Jonathan      Marchessault cut the Comet's lead to one 31 seconds later      with a shorthanded tally from the slot. Brett Connolly and      Gourde earned points with the helper. Marchessault evened the      score with another shorthanded goal 15 seconds later. Mike      Angelidis won the faceoff in the right circle.
